In this review of the Pathfinder School X Geopress Nesting Cup with Lid the bottom line is simple: this is a durable, space-saving steel cup built for people who cook and boil on the trail. The reviewer found the single biggest reason to buy is its combination of heavy-duty 304 stainless steel construction and the tall, slim nesting profile that fits inside many bottles and packs. For anyone building a minimalist kit, survival setup, or compact camp kitchen the cup's rugged build and integrated measurements make it a practical daily carry item.
Key Features
- 304 stainless steel construction: Resists corrosion and tolerates open-flame heating so it stands up to repeated backcountry use.
- Heavy-duty bat wing handles: Fold flat for packing but provide a secure, comfortable grip when pouring hot liquids or stirring.
- Internal volume graduations: Markings for 16oz/30oz (500ml/900ml) make measuring ingredients straightforward while cooking or boiling water.
- Strainer lid included: The stainless steel lid has integrated strainer holes for draining liquids, retaining heat, and speeding boil times when used as a cover.
- Tall, slim nesting design: Designed to nest with most water bottles and outdoor kits, saving space in bug-out bags and minimalist packs.
Who It's For
Backpackers who favor minimalist, multiuse gear will appreciate how the cup nests inside bottles and compresses down with other kit; the durable stainless body also fits bushcrafters and survivalists who need gear that can be heated directly over flame. The built-in measurements make it useful for anyone who prepares dehydrated meals or uses exact liquid volumes in the field.
Those who should look elsewhere include ultralight hikers for whom every ounce matters and users who need insulated drinkware for long heat retention; this is a stainless steel cup focused on durability and compact packing, not maximum insulation or featherweight construction.

Specifications
| Brand | The Pathfinder School |
| Material | 304 stainless steel |
| Capacity | 30oz / 900ml |
| Graduations | 16oz, 30oz / 500ml, 900ml |
| Handles | Folding bat wing handles |
| Lid | Stainless steel lid with integrated strainer holes |
| Design | Tall, slim nesting cup for compact gear setups |
